Report: Southampton's Lavia chooses Chelsea over Liverpool

Chelsea and Liverpool’s off-pitch battles continue after Romeo Lavia chose to join the London club Monday, according to The Athletic’s David Ornstein.

The Reds agreed to a deal worth £60 million for the Southampton midfielder, The Guardian’s Jacob Steinberg reports, but Chelsea are now set to strike an agreement for a similar amount. A £50-million sum plus add-ons should be enough for the Blues to get the move over the line, Ornstein adds.

Liverpool also lost out to Chelsea in their pursuit of Brighton & Hove Albion’s Moises Caicedo.
